CHART OVERVIEW
On this week’s chart, the ‘Midnights’ album keeps breaking and setting new records. Taylor Swift becomes the first artist to hold the entire Top 13 in a single week, with “Would’ve, Could’ve, Should’ve” entering the region for the first time, reaching a new peak of #8 — the thirteenth Top 10 hit off the album. Swift also set a new record as the first artist to hold 19 songs within the Top 20 in the same week. “Anti-Hero” becomes the artist’s longest-running #1 song, breaking the tie with “The Man”, “august”, and “coney island”, whose stayed atop for 2 weeks each.

Following the release of the 25th anniversary edition of Spice Girls’ sophomore album ‘Spiceworld’, its lead single “Spice Up Your Life” re-entered the chart at #26. ALICE (formerly ELRIS) achieves their second chart entry, four years after their first, as “DANCE ON” debuts at #33, a new career high. APink ChoBom’s “Copycat” re-entered the chart at #37. A fun fact is that all of the song’s 3-week chart-run were non-consecutive. OnlyOneOf’s “Zurui Onna” marks the first Japanese-language song in over one year to spent at least 10 weeks inside chart, since Nogizaka46’s Top 10 hit “Gomen ne Finger Crossed”, and the first ever for a male act.

NOTES
This week’s points for Taylor Swift’s “Anti-Hero” includes its remix with Bleachers, being responsible for nearly 26% of the song’s total points — it did enough points to enter the Top 25. As well as Spice Girls’ “Spice Up Your Life”, which 34.5% of its points were from alternative versions of the song.
